# Venues Categories ### Overview Venues categories are different types of venues that each venue will be associated with. These include arenas, symphony halls, conference halls, and so on. ### Creating A New Venue category The following image shows the Venue Category screen. To add a category, click **Components** > **JomEvents** > **Venues Categories**. Click **New** to create a new category. New Creates a new catgory entry. You must create separate entries for each level of depth that you need.
Edit Provides the edit mode to make changes to the existing level or titles created.
Publish Publishes the created category entry.
Unpublish Removes the entry from the list of published category entries
Archive Archives category entries that are not used anymore.
Trash Deletes the category entry that is not required anymore.
Rebuild Refreshes to incorporate the changes made to the entries.

#### Publishing tab After you have provided the above information, you can provide the publishing information in the Publishing tab as seen in the following image. You can change the values for the given options using the following table.
Status Based on the status seen here, the visibility changes as follows: - Published - Entries are visible on the front-end. - Unpublished – Entries are invisible in the front-end, but can be published later. - Archived – Older entries that are not ready for deletion yet. - Trashed – Older entries that should be removed.
Access Access level for site users is as follows: - Public access grant access to everybody. - Registered access grants access only to registered and logged in users. - Special access only grants access to users specified as “Special”.
Language Select the language for the category entry.
ID Category ID, which can be used in modules, plugins and menus.
Created by User name who created the entry.
Created Date Date when the entry was created.
